ORS 130.640: UTC 709. Reimbursement of expenses.

(1) A trustee is entitled to be reimbursed out of the trust property, with reasonable interest if appropriate, for:
(a) Expenses that were properly incurred in the administration of the trust; and
(b) To the extent necessary to prevent unjust enrichment of the trust, expenses that were not properly incurred in the administration of the trust.
(2) A trustee is entitled to be reimbursed out of the trust property or from property that has been distributed from the trust, with reasonable interest, for an advance of money made by the trustee for the protection of the trust. [2005 c.348 §58]
